First of all why would you recommend Soundview/Castle Hill? These are not areas an outsider should be moving into cold, I dont care what skin color/age/race they are.

Second of all why would you recommend the East Bronx in general, even the nice areas. Shes probably not going to have parking by Yankee Stadium. If shes in Throggs Neck your talking bus/car to Westchester Square, ride down the 6 to 125th St and then back up to 161st on the 4...this is nonsense. She should live off the 4 or D, whether Woodlawn, Harlem, UES, UWS, etc depending on her preference for a more sensible commute.
